摘要
随着大型综合码头的建设,港口工程生产效率低、信息化水平低、返工高、施工工序复杂等问题日益严重,且传统的管理模型不足以解决现存问题。在使用虚拟设计与施工(VDC)技术的实践工程中发现,VDC技术可以促使建设项目目标的高质量实现,可以有效解决目前港口工程建设过程中的诸多问题。文章结合POP模型对VDC技术进行介绍,以上海崇明岛公共货运码头为例,阐述了VDC技术在港口工程中的应用。在VDC技术应用过程中,发现结合可视化方法、不同功能软硬件等,VDC技术可以对港口工程的建设进行有效预测和控制,帮助各阶段参与方进行科学地决策,促进参与方间的沟通和协作效率,避免造成返工和变更。VDC技术通过三维可视化和专业分析,可以有效进行施工现场的模拟,其对于安全施工等起到了促进作用。
With the construction of large-scale comprehensive wharf,the problems of low production efficiency,low information level,high rework and complex construction procedures of port engineering are becoming more and more serious.The traditional management model is not enough to solve the existing problems.In the practical engineering using VDC technology,it is found that VDC technology can promote the high-quality realization of the objectives of the construction project and effectively solve many problems in the current port engineering construction process.This paper introduces VDC technology combined with POP model,and takes Shanghai Chongming Island public cargo terminal as an example to illustrate the application of VDC technology in port engineering.During the application of VDC technology,it is found that combined with visualization methods,different functional software and hardware,VDC technology can effectively predict and control the construction of port engineering,help participants in each stage make scientific decisions,promote the efficiency of communication and cooperation among participants,and avoid rework and change.VDC technology can effectively simulate the construction site through three-dimensional visualization and professional analysis,which plays a role in promoting safe construction.
